Official figures show fall in London road casualties but concerns remain about “vulnerable” groups
London’s transport agency says 2,092 people were killed or seriously injured in 2015, down from 2,167 the year before and a 42 per cent reduction on the 2005-09 baseline against which road safety is measured.

Jules Pipe to join Sadiq Khan’s City Hall team as planning deputy
Pipe has been Hackney’s directly elected mayor since 2002 and has led London Councils, the all-party body which represents local boroughs and runs the capital’s Freedom Pass, since 2010.
